在gmail中更正输入电子邮件地址(或地址)后,我们围绕此地址设置了框架,如下图所示:
在Android和EditText的情况下,我该如何做类似的事情?有没有自动执行验证的库? (我知道可能我可以使用形状绘制一些东西,但它看起来并不那么容易......)。
EDIT。我已经发现了好的图书馆,而且效果很好。 https://github.com/splitwise/TokenAutoComplete
答案 0 :(得分:1)
不了解验证库。但是对于edittext的背景,您可以使用addTextChangedListener()。在它的onTextChanged()方法中检查您要分配用于触发验证的密钥。如果验证结果成功,则可以以编程方式创建textveiw更改其背景,将该验证的电子邮件地址的值分配给textview,并将该文本视图放在编辑文本中。